**Ring of Salt** *Ring, rare* This clear ring is made of crystalline salt. Donning or removing the ring requires an action. While wearing this ring, ghosts can neither move through nor possess you. If a ghost is already in your space or possessing you when you put on the *ring of salt*, it's forcibly ejected from you to the nearest unoccupied space and takes 1d10 force damage. Furthermore, the first time on each of your turns when you move through a ghost's space, that ghost must succeed on a DC 15 Dexterity saving throw or be pushed to the nearest unoccupied space and take 1d10 force damage. Each time a ghost is forcibly ejected or pushed by the ring, the ring has a 10 percent chance of being destroyed and crumbling into a negligible pile of salt.   *"I walk among death without its fear.
